Latest Patents
Mário Triches, Jr. holds a patent for an "Airfoil flap assembly with split flap track fairing system." This invention features a flap track fairing system that is divided into a forward immovably fixed portion and an aft movable portion. The fixed forward portion is securely attached to the main wing structure of an aircraft, while the movable aft portion connects to either the flap deployment mechanism or the lower surface of the flap. A separation line is established between the forward and aft portions to ensure that the movable part does not interfere with the flap fairing structure during the flap extension and retraction cycle. Additionally, an airflow deflector is strategically positioned near the forward separation edge of the aft fairing portion to direct airflow away from the interior space of the fairing when the flap is deployed.
Career Highlights
Mário Triches, Jr. is currently employed at Embraer S.A., a leading aerospace company known for its innovative aircraft designs. His work at Embraer has allowed him to apply his expertise in aeronautical engineering and contribute to the advancement of aviation technology.
